Gwinnett K-9 officer continues to recover from gunshot wounds
Police said the 17-year-old shot the K-9 officer twice. Cpl. Carlyle rushed Kai to the veterinary hospital, where he remained for about three weeks. A short time after he was released, Kai's care team made the difficult decision to amputate his injured leg.
